To include A level Biology and a second relevant subject (Mathematics, Physics, Chemistry, Geography, Geology, Environmental Science or Environmental Studies, Applied Science, Marine Science).
BTEC National Diploma/QCF Extended Diploma/RQF National Extended Diploma: DDM to DDD in Science. Note that this is subject to the exact modules you have studied, please contact admissions@plymouth.ac.uk stating explicitly the full list of modules within your qualification.
International Baccalaureate: 28-32 points overall to include Higher Level Biology and a second relevant  Science subject. English and Maths can be considered within. 
Access To Higher Education: Science-based diplomas, 33 credits in science-based units at merit including a minimum of 12 credits in biology units and 21 credits in a second science subject. 
We would usually expect GCSE English and Mathematics at grade C / 4, or equivalent.
We welcome applicants with international qualifications. To view other accepted qualifications please refer to our tariff glossary.
For candidates that do not have traditional qualifications, our BSc (Hons) Biological Sciences with Foundation Year course provides a route onto this degree.
